Elementary School Teacher Rambam Day School
At Rambam Day School, located at Temple Beth Am, we are seeking passionate and experienced educators who inspire and nurture students' growth in all areas—intellectual, emotional, physical, spiritual, and social. Our teachers create warm, engaging classrooms that foster curiosity, resilience, and confidence. We value collaboration with families and believe in empowering students with life skills that prepare them for the future.
Educators at Rambam are dedicated to designing dynamic, hands-on learning environments that encourage exploration and growth. With a deep understanding of child development, our educators create age-appropriate, interdisciplinary projects that integrate Jewish values and traditions, while supporting each child’s unique academic and emotional needs.

R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Assess students' academic strengths and areas for improvement using a variety of assessment tools (e.g., benchmarks, MAP testing, formative assessments).
- Analyze student data and collaborate with teachers to design and implement targeted instructional strategies and interventions that address individual student needs.
- Monitor student progress, adjusting instructional approaches as needed.
- Collaborate with classroom teachers to plan instructional strategies and assess student progress toward academic goals.
- Collaborate regularly with the team to share successes and brainstorm solutions to challenges throughout the year
- Communicate regularly with parents about student progress and classroom expectations.
- Maintain accurate records of student achievement and progress.
- Promote a positive learning environment by motivating students and fostering higher-order thinking.
- Stay current on best practices and educational strategies through professional development opportunities.
- Foster the belief that all students can succeed academically through grade-level instruction and targeted interventions.
TEACHER QUALIFICATIONS\/ SKILLS
- Valid teaching certification (appropriate to position)
- Education:Minimum of a Bachelor's degree in Education or a related field (Master's degree preferred).
- Special Education certification and/or Master's degree (preferred)
- Expertise in Reading/Mathematics instruction and remediation
- Proven ability to differentiate lessons for diverse learners
- Skilled in using various instructional strategies to support all learning styles
- Experience with research-based interventions and improving student achievement
- Strong communication skills with students, staff, and parents
- Proficient in using data to drive instruction
- Familiarity with Tiered Instruction and grade-level appropriate teaching methods
- Comfortable working with students from diverse backgrounds and abilities
- Excellent time management and organizational skills
- Proficient with technology (assistive tools, software like Google Classroom, SeeSaw, etc.)
